Description

Persol 2.5 % Soap is an antiseptic that is effectively used on the skin to treat acne (pimples, blackheads and whiteheads) on your face, back and chest. It works by stopping the growth of bacteria on your skin. Persol 2.5 % Soap reduces painful lumps and clears the dirt and excess oil from your skin. Persol 2.5 % Soap shows side effects like dry skin, redness of the skin, itching, skin peeling and burning sensation at the application site. Do not use Persol 2.5 % Soap if you are previously allergic to it. Contact your doctor immediately if you notice any side effects. Persol 2.5 % Soap has to be used as per your doctor’s instructions. Persol 2.5 % Soap is not recommended for use in children below 12 years of age. Consult your doctor before using Persol 2.5 % Soap if you are pregnant or are breastfeeding.

Uses of Persol 2.5 % Soap

What is it prescribed for?

Acne vulgaris

Acne (Acne vulgaris) is a long term skin disease that occurs when the hair follicles in the skin get blocked. This acne occurs as whiteheads, blackheads, pimples, pustules, and cysts. Persol 2.5 % Soap is a safe and effective treatment for acne in adolescents and adults.

General warnings

Skin peeling

Persol 2.5 % Soap may cause irritation and peeling of the skin when applied the first few times. This effect is not harmful and subsides within few days.

For external use

Persol 2.5 % Soap is recommended for external use only. Avoid contact with the eyes, mucous membranes, or open wounds.

Skin irritation

Persol 2.5 % Soap may increase the skin irritation, therefore, should not be used if you have dry skin.

Use in children

Persol 2.5 % Soap is not recommended for use in children under 12 years of age, since the safety and efficacy data is unavailable.

Missed Dose

If you miss applying Persol 2.5 % Soap at your regular time, apply it as soon as you remember.

Overdose

An overdose of Persol 2.5 % Soap can cause a rare but severe allergic reaction like severe skin irritation or rash. In such cases, contact your doctor immediately.

Persol 2.5 % Soap is for external use only. Avoid contact with your eyes, lips, or mouth. While using Persol 2.5 % Soap, wet the affected area with water, apply the soap on the affected area and clean thoroughly after 2-3 minutes. Do not use Persol 2.5 % Soap frequently/more than prescribed as this may cause excessive drying. Finish the entire course of treatment even if your symptoms begin to clear up after a few days. If irritation persists for a prolonged time, stop using Persol 2.5 % Soap and consult your doctor.
